logo

Output bc29360714180eaf63e5806a17c273ec7368aed25a620567d3562806902ce4c0:1

value
128989154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44451b230fd7e32f87ca6db070d484e6bd75899 OP_EQUAL
address
3M3P27D354TZTnx2xGXFYdHhdyZu4y3vVq
transaction
bc29360714180eaf63e5806a17c273ec7368aed25a620567d3562806902ce4c0